Abstract: The paper shows how to calculate the probability of being able to discriminate between two blood samples using a single test. The distribution of the population with respect to this test criterion is assumed to be known. The paper goes on to describe how to calculate the probability of being able to discriminate between two blood samples using a battery of such tests. The tests are assumed to be independent. The actual calculations are made for a battery of seven such tests. Finally, two conditions which tests of good discriminating power should satisfy are stated and proved.

Abstract: Consideration of the arctic configuration of the Caledonides leads to a distinction between eastern and western geosynclinal belts. The western belt, comprising the East Greenland, East Svalbard and southern Barents Sea Caledonides is postulated to continue northwards into the Lomonosov Ridge, whilst the western Spitsbergen Caledonides are thought to have originated as part of the North Greenland geosyncline which is also thought to continue northwards to form the western part of the Lomonosov Ridge. The eastern Caledonian geosynclinal belt comprising the Scandinavian Caledonides appears to swing eastwards to link with the Timan Chain and possibly the Urals.The already postulated (‘Proto-Atlantic’) ocean concept is reviewed in the light of the Arctic Caledonides and named Iapetus. Faunal provincialism suggests that the ocean was in existence up to early Ordovician but had substantially closed by mid Ordovician times. Possible relics of the suture marking the closure of this ocean suggest that it lay to the west of the Arctic Scandinavian Caledonides trending NE to latitude 70° N and thence veered eastwards separating the southern Barents Sea Caledonides from those of Arctic Scandinavia, possibly connecting with the northern Uralian ocean. A previous branch of the ocean may have separated East Svalbard and East Greenland as an ocean-like trough. A further (pre-Arctic) ocean may have existed to the north of the North Greenland–Lomonosov Ridge geosynclines. This is named Pelagus.The closure of these oceanic areas and the deformation of the bordering geosynclines delineates three principal continental plates, namely, Baltic, Greenland and Barents Plates. Their relative dominantly E–W motion up to Silurian times produced compression between the Greenland and both the Baltic and Barents plates but dextral transpression and transcurrence between the latter plates. In Late Silurian to Devonian times an increasing northward component controlled late Caledonian transpression and sinistral transcurrence between the Greenland plate and the combined Baltic and Barents plates.

Abstract: 1. Measurements of transfer factor and sub-maximal exercise ventilation and cardiac frequency have been made on twenty women with iron-deficiency anaemia (Hb 8–9 g/100 ml) before and after ‘treatment’ with iron or placebo tablets and on control subjects. 2. The exercise ventilation, cardiac frequency and oxygen uptake were independent of haemoglobin concentration but the transfer factor was lower in the test than in control subjects and was increased by iron but not by placebo treatment. The results support the validity of the reaction-rate data for carbon monoxide with oxyhaemoglobin of Roughton & Forster (1957) despite evidence to the contrary from other studies. 3. In interpretation of sub-maximal exercise ventilation and cardiac frequency in iron-deficiency anaemia no allowance need be made for variation in haemoglobin concentration in the range 8–15 g/100 ml. For transfer factor a correction should be made by using a variant of the relationship of Roughton & Forster (1957).

Abstract: It has been suggested that glycosylation is a means of labelling proteins for intracellular recognition and export. This hypothesis is rejected in favour of the idea that the attached carbohydrate determines the extracellular fate of the protein molecule.

Abstract: Summary Species of submersed and floating-leaved aquatic macrophytes have been place in a series based on their patterns of occurrence in an ordination of floristic lists. Two chemical parameters from lake water analyses are correlated with the species assemblage in individual lakes and trophic categories are defined on the quantitative chemical characteristics of lake waters. The range and limiting tolerance of solute content for many aquatic species are described and related to these trophic categories. Restiction towards eutrophic conditions is considered as an obligate relatinship reflecting physiological demands. Some dystrophic and oligotrophic species are shown to have wide tolerance and are thought to be excluded from sites of higher trophic status by competition rather than physiological limitation.

Abstract: Nicotinamide adenine dinucleotide (NAD) and reduced NAD (NADH) levels have been measured in bacterial cultures. The cofactors were assayed by using the very sensitive cycling assay described previously by Cartier. Control experiments showed that the level of total NAD(H) falls during harvesting, and so samples were taken quickly from growing cultures and extracted immediately without separating the cells from the medium. Total NAD(H) ranged from 4.0 to 11.7 mumoles/g of dry cells for three facultative organisms, Klebsiella aerogenes, Escherichia coli, and Staphylococcus albus. NADH was remarkably constant in these bacteria; only one out of ten series of determinations was outside the range 1.4 to 1.9 mumoles/g of dry cells. NAD(+) showed much greater variation. An anaerobe (Clostridium welchii) had significantly more total NAD(H) whereas an aerobe Pseudomonas aeruginosa had about as much NAD(H) as the facultative organisms. NAD and NADH were measured during growth: once more NADH was much more constant than NAD. During change-over between aerobiosis and anaerobiosis, NADH showed a temporary increase but then returned to a constant level, whereas NAD changed from high aerobically to low anaerobically. These results are discussed in terms of the control mechanisms that may be involved.

Abstract: 1. Partially purified preparations of rat brain 4-aminobutyrate aminotransferase were inhibited in a time-dependent manner by ethanolamine O-sulphate. The inhibition was not reversed by dialysis. 2. The inhibitor formed an initial reversible complex with the enzyme (Ki=4.4×10−4m) and the rate of inactivation followed pseudo-first-order kinetics (k=7.15×10−4s−1). The inclusion of 4-aminobutyrate markedly slowed the rate of inactivation. 3. Ethanolamine O-sulphate did not inhibit glutamate decarboxylase, alanine aminotransferase or aspartate aminotransferase. 4. Intracisternal injection of ethanolamine O-sulphate into rats led to rapid inactivation of 4-aminobutyrate aminotransferase in vivo.

Abstract: 1 Elastins were isolated from the visceral pleuras and parenchymas of lungs of humans of different ages 2 The elastin content of pleuras increased whereas that of parenchymas remained constant with increasing age 3 The amino acid compositions and carbohydrate contents of elastins isolated from both pulmonary tissues changed in the same way with increasing age of the subjects These changes were similar to those observed in elastins isolated from the aorta 4 Similar glycoproteins were isolated from pleuras and aortas, and were more difficult to extract from the elastins of older subjects Contamination with these glycoproteins was responsible for the changes in composition of elastin, as the age of the tissue from which it was extracted increased 5 The amount of the cross-linking amino acids desmosine and isodesmosine was lower in elastins isolated from both aorta and pulmonary tissues of senile subjects than those from younger subjects

Abstract: Two experiments are described in which, by a divided visual field technique, simple non-verbal stimulus material is directed to either the right hemisphere, left hemisphere, or divided between the hemispheres. It is found that when material to be matched is shared between the hemispheres, response latencies are reduced, suggesting increased capacity for the processing of such information and supporting the hypothesis that each hemisphere contains its own processing and analysing system. When the material is directed to only one hemisphere, and a bimanual motor response required, a relative superiority of the right hemisphere is found. If the response required is a vocal response, then further relative blocking of the processing undertaken by the left hemisphere is observed.

Abstract: Conditions based on previous assays with potassium p-acetylphenyl sulphate have been established for the specific assay of arylsulphatase C in rat tissues. The enzyme has optimum activity with 40mm substrate at pH8.0 in the presence of 0.1m-phosphate buffer. Under these conditions arylsulphatase C can be assayed without interference from the other arylsulphatase enzymes present and is useful as a marker for the endoplasmic reticulum in cell-fractionation studies.

Abstract: Rate equations with fluctuation operators describing the quantum nature of the transitions are solved for (i) the exponential band tails model of a semiconductor laser at 80 °K, and (ii) the parabolic bands with no k-selection model of a semiconductor laser at room temperature. The results show the same characteristic features as those of Haug [1]. Above threshold a sharp resonance in the noise spectrum is found in the GHz region, the resonance frequency increasing with current and temperature. Simple analytic expressions for this resonance frequency are given. The results indicate that the low-frequency part of the relative photon noise spectrum has its maximum value just below threshold, while that of the relative electron noise spectrum has its maximum value just above threshold. In addition, it would appear from these results that intensity fluctuations in the light output and junction current of room-temperature c.w. lasers are likely to be of less importance than those of c.w. lasers at liquid nitrogen temperature. Abstract: Detailed studies on the hydrolysis of p -acetylphenyl sulphate and oestrone sulphate by rat liver preparations strongly indicate that arylsulphatase C and oestrogen sulphatase are the same enzyme. Liver is the richest source of both enzymes, which have identical intracellular distributions, being localized mainly in the microsomal fraction. Low oestrogen sulphatase and arylsulphatase C activities were present in foetal liver and these increased at a similar rate after birth. The activities of the enzymes in an ethionine-induced hepatoma were similarly low. Results of heat inactivation, mixed-substrate and competitive-inhibition experiments employing liver microsomal fractions were also consistent with one enzyme being involved. Oestradiol-17β 3-sulphate was also hydrolysed by microsomal preparations and activity towards both this substrate and oestrone sulphate was inhibited by oestrone and oestradiol-17β. The physiological significance of this inhibition is discussed.

The methods of Kubelka and Munk, for the prediction of reflection by particulate suspensions, have been widely used in the paint and paper-making industries. In the two-flux theory on which these methods are based, the absorption and scattering properties of the suspension are represented by the coefficients K and S, respectively. There has long been uncertainty about the physical meaning of these coefficients, limiting the appeal of a theory that is otherwise attractively simple. Two recent analyses of the reflectance problem now make it possible to interpret these coefficients in terms of the more familiar scatter­ ing and absorption cross sections. Abstract: A three phase transformer test facility has been used for measuring the localized power loss and flux distribution within the core. The flux and loss distributions in the T-joint of a core with simple double overlap joints have been investigated. The flux density distribution was measured by an array of search coils wound on individual laminations, and the localized power loss was found by measuring the initial rate of temperature rise using miniature thermocouples. For measurements made in the range of flux densities from 1.1 to 1.6 T, the inner edges of the yoke and limb laminations were the highest loss areas, up to 30% higher than the mean core loss. These regions of high power loss were found to be due to a high third harmonic flux density component being present. The fundamental component of flux density tended to follow the rolling direction of both yoke and limb laminations; however, some deviation from the rolling direction was present in the case of other harmonics.

Abstract: 1. High rates of state 3 pyruvate oxidation are dependent on high concentrations of inorganic phosphate and a predominance of ADP in the intramitochondrial pool of adenine nucleotides. The latter requirement is most marked at alkaline pH values, where ATP is profoundly inhibitory. 2. Addition of CaCl2 during state 4, state 3 (Chance & Williams, 1955) or uncoupled pyruvate oxidation causes a marked inhibition in the rate of oxygen uptake when low concentrations of mitochondria are employed, but may lead to an enhancement of state 4 oxygen uptake when very high concentrations of mitochondria are used. 3. These properties are consistent with the kinetics of the NAD-linked isocitrate dehydrogenase (EC 1.1.1.41) from this tissue, which is activated by isocitrate, citrate, ADP, phosphate and H+ ions, and inhibited by ATP, NADH and Ca2+. 4. Studies of the redox state of NAD and cytochrome c show that addition of ADP during pyruvate oxidation causes a slight reduction, whereas addition during glycerol phosphate oxidation causes a `classical' oxidation. Nevertheless, it is concluded that pyruvate oxidation is probably limited by the respiratory chain in state 4 and by the NAD-linked isocitrate dehydrogenase in state 3. 5. The oxidation of 2-oxoglutarate by swollen mitochondria is also stimulated by high concentrations of ADP and phosphate, and is not uncoupled by arsenate.
